org.apache.hadoop.yarn.api.records.impl.pb
Class ReservationRequestPBImpl

java.lang.Object
  extended by org.apache.hadoop.yarn.api.records.ReservationRequest
      extended by org.apache.hadoop.yarn.api.records.impl.pb.ReservationRequestPBImpl
All Implemented Interfaces:
Comparable<org.apache.hadoop.yarn.api.records.ReservationRequest>

@InterfaceAudience.Private
@InterfaceStability.Unstable
public class ReservationRequestPBImpl
extends org.apache.hadoop.yarn.api.records.ReservationRequest


Nested Class Summary
 
Nested classes/interfaces inherited from class org.apache.hadoop.yarn.api.records.ReservationRequest
org.apache.hadoop.yarn.api.records.ReservationRequest.ReservationRequestComparator
 
Constructor Summary
ReservationRequestPBImpl()
           
ReservationRequestPBImpl(org.apache.hadoop.yarn.proto.YarnProtos.ReservationRequestProto proto)
           
 
Method Summary
 org.apache.hadoop.yarn.api.records.Resource getCapability()
           
 int getConcurrency()
           
 long getDuration()
           
 int getNumContainers()
           
 org.apache.hadoop.yarn.proto.YarnProtos.ReservationRequestProto getProto()
           
 void setCapability(org.apache.hadoop.yarn.api.records.Resource capability)
           
 void setConcurrency(int numContainers)
           
 void setDuration(long duration)
           
 void setNumContainers(int numContainers)
           
 String toString()
           
 
Methods inherited from class org.apache.hadoop.yarn.api.records.ReservationRequest
compareTo, equals, hashCode, newInstance, newInstance
 
Methods inherited from class java.lang.Object
clone, finalize, getClass, notify, notifyAll, wait, wait, wait
 

Constructor Detail

ReservationRequestPBImpl

public ReservationRequestPBImpl()

ReservationRequestPBImpl

public ReservationRequestPBImpl(org.apache.hadoop.yarn.proto.YarnProtos.ReservationRequestProto proto)
Method Detail

getProto

public org.apache.hadoop.yarn.proto.YarnProtos.ReservationRequestProto getProto()

getCapability

public org.apache.hadoop.yarn.api.records.Resource getCapability()
Specified by:
getCapability in class org.apache.hadoop.yarn.api.records.ReservationRequest

setCapability

public void setCapability(org.apache.hadoop.yarn.api.records.Resource capability)
Specified by:
setCapability in class org.apache.hadoop.yarn.api.records.ReservationRequest

getNumContainers

public int getNumContainers()
Specified by:
getNumContainers in class org.apache.hadoop.yarn.api.records.ReservationRequest

setNumContainers

public void setNumContainers(int numContainers)
Specified by:
setNumContainers in class org.apache.hadoop.yarn.api.records.ReservationRequest

getConcurrency

public int getConcurrency()
Specified by:
getConcurrency in class org.apache.hadoop.yarn.api.records.ReservationRequest

setConcurrency

public void setConcurrency(int numContainers)
Specified by:
setConcurrency in class org.apache.hadoop.yarn.api.records.ReservationRequest

getDuration

public long getDuration()
Specified by:
getDuration in class org.apache.hadoop.yarn.api.records.ReservationRequest

setDuration

public void setDuration(long duration)
Specified by:
setDuration in class org.apache.hadoop.yarn.api.records.ReservationRequest

toString

public String toString()
Overrides:
toString in class Object


Copyright © 2014 Apache Software Foundation. All Rights Reserved.